“My Liberation Notes” has unveiled new stills of Kim Ji Won!

JTBC’s “My Literation Notes” is about three siblings who want to escape their stifling lives and the events that unfold when a mysterious outsider comes to their town.

Kim Ji Won stars as Yeom Mi Jung, the youngest sibling, who is introverted and timid until she decides to make a change in order to liberate herself from her dreary and monochrome life. Lee Min Ki stars as Yeom Chang Hee, the middle sibling, who had hoped for an exciting life in the city but now lives aimlessly without any ambition. Lee El plays Yeom Ki Jung, the eldest sibling, who feels like her youth has been wasted on commuting back and forth to her job in Seoul and is desperate to find love. Son Seok Gu stars as Mr. Gu, the charming and mysterious outsider who suddenly arrives in town and gets drunk every day, having lost his purpose in life.

On March 22, JTBC released the first stills of Kim Ji Won as the introverted Yeom Mi Jung that depict her typical dreary day. With an indifferent facial expression, she starts her morning by waiting at the bus stop. However, it appears as if what she’s truly waiting for is far beyond the bus and anything else she can see at the moment.

While on the bus, Yeom Mi Jung looks lost in thought and her inner concerns start to show in her expression. However, she puts all her worries aside in the office as she puts on a bright smile in front of her co-workers. The way Yeom Mi Jung diligently navigates her exhausting daily life will serve a relatable story to viewers.

Through her role as Yeom Mi Jung, Kim Ji Won will portray a new image of her acting. As a natural introvert, Yeom Mi Jung has lived her whole life feeling like the only person left on the planet. Every type of relationship feels like a lot to handle and her everyday life feels like homework. However, when she’s with her siblings, she still always quietly does her part. Yeom Mi Jung works as a contractor for the design team of a card company and has thus learned to put on the bright face of a member of society, but her inner feelings are always achromatic. In order to escape her indescribably heavy heart, Yeom Mi Jung decides to write her own “liberation notes” and she runs into the mysterious Mr. Gu in the process.

The actress shared, “Mi Jung has a calmness to her that isn’t easily swayed. Rather than move in the footsteps of others, she is someone who moves to the sound of her own heart. She’s a character who deeply contemplates her own life. Due to that, she yearns for liberation and is a big character.”

Kim Ji Won continued, “I hope the transformation of emotions that Mi Jung experiences is showcased well. I wanted to properly show the flow of emotions that Mi Jung experiences as time goes by, so I spoke a lot with the director.”

JTBC’s “My Liberation Notes” premieres on April 9 at 10:30 p.m. KST. Check out a teaser here!
